Why do LGBTQ community members even have their own pronouns?
LGB people will usually use their birth pronouns, as those are sexual orientations and don't affect gender.

T people will generally use the pronouns associated with the gender they have transitioned to, as that is generally how.

Q+ is where it all gets a bit more complex pronoun wise, many people who fall under this umbrella term define themselves as non-binary, and as such don't want to be referred to as either female or male, and choose alternative pronouns to express that.
